    Abstract: A fan control system is provided, which is used for dissipating heat from a computer device. The fan control system includes a control interface and multiple fan modules. Each one of the fan modules includes a controller, a fan, and a sensor. The controller correspondingly controls a rotational speed of the fan according to environment data transmitted by the connected sensor. The controller transmits real-time fan information to the control interface, and the real-time fan information includes the environment data, identification data, wind direction data, and rotational speed data. The control interface receives the real-time fan information transmitted by the fan modules, and the control interface controls at least one of the fans to change a current rotational speed according to operation information and the real-time fan information transmitted by the fan modules. The fan control system allows the computer device to achieve a good heat-dissipation effect.

    Abstract: A mouse and a gaming system are respectively provided. The gaming system includes a mouse and an intermediate application program. The mouse includes an operation module, a solid-state disk (SSD), and a processing module. The processing module is connected to an electronic device. When the electronic device runs a game, the processing module records an operation signal generated by an operation of a user in the SSD. The processing module can store settings made by the user to the game and to the mouse in the SSD. When the game is ended in the electronic device, the processing module stores a game result information in the SSD. When the electronic device runs the same game and the same mouse is used to play the same game, the user can read the settings in the SSD to quickly perform the same settings on the game and the mouse.

    Abstract: According to various embodiments, a filtering device may be provided. The filtering device may include: an ultraviolet light sensor configured to sense ultraviolet light; an infra-red light sensor configured to sense infra-red light; a visible light sensor configured to sense visible light; a filter selection circuit configured to select a filter based on at least two outputs selected from a list of outputs consisting of: an output of the ultraviolet light sensor; an output of the infra-red light sensor; and an output of the visible light sensor; and a filtering circuit configured to apply the selected filter.

    Abstract: An electronic assembly includes a power supply, a wireless access point, and wired network connectivity. Power for the wireless access point may come from the power supply, or alternatively, from power through the wired network. The power supply can also provide removable power to a portable information device. The wireless access point may optionally be configured to communicate wirelessly only with one particular wireless client.

    Abstract: Integrated touch pad and pen-based tablet input devices and systems are described herein. At least some illustrative embodiments include an input device that includes a touch pad that detects when a surface of the touch pad is contacted by a finger of a user (the surface of the touch pad defining a first x-y plane), and a pen-based tablet comprising a sensing array, wherein the sensing array detects when a stylus associated with the sensing array is proximate to the sensing array (the sensing array defining a second x-y plane that is beneath the first x-y plane). The touch pad is mounted above and proximate to the sensing array, such that the sensing array detects when the stylus is proximate to the surface of the touch pad.
